I will first of all say that vinyl is my preferred source.  I love my analog setup and always prefer the sound over streaming.  Sometimes it is close and typically it is significantly better

Right after ordering the open-box N100SC, there was an N10 for sale here that was just a few more $ so I bought it.  I returned the N100SC without opening.  I got the N10 setup on Monday afternoon and my first impression was impressive.  There was no doubt it improved the sound over my Node2i.  The more I listened the less I was impressed.  I really wanted to be blown away but after a couple days realized I was not.  

I also don't do a lot of critical listening with streaming.  When I am doing housework, cooking or just moving around the house doing other things I will often stream.  When I am sitting in my music room, I typically play records.  

I decided it I could not justify the cost.  It also made it where a new digital cable was going to be required as my 0.5m was now not long enough.  This added expense further made my decision.  I posted it yesterday afternoon and was sold within a few hours and my net after all the dust settled was +$8...LOL

I am very happy I tried it out and maybe another time in my life I will appreciate that upgrade more.  It was disappointing and made me wonder about my hearing.  I hear other upgrades quite easily.  I recently went from a Schiit Gumby to Yggy and that was noticeable.  I soon after that found a DAC8 to match my other AR gear so got it and was even more of an upgrade and did more for my system than the N10 did over the Node.  I have made advancements in my turntable that were also significant like I recently got a Kiseki Purple Heart to replace my Benz Micro Wood SM.  That was a huge improvement.  Oh well....like I said, another time maybe but it's great how the Aurender products are helping out everyone else.  They are gorgeous with an incredible build quality.
